The chemical class referred to as MIP-β Inhibitors would encompass a diverse range of compounds that have the capacity to interfere with the function, signaling, or interaction of MIP-1β with its receptors. These inhibitors operate through several mechanisms, which include antagonism of the chemokine receptors (such as CCR5) that MIP-1β binds to, or by binding directly to the chemokines themselves, thereby neutralizing their activity. Compounds like Maraviroc, TAK-779, SCH-C, Vicriviroc, and Aplaviroc are small molecule antagonists that bind to CCR5 and prevent MIP-1β from triggering intracellular signaling pathways that lead to inflammation and cell migration. This blockade of receptor interaction is key in moderating the biological activities that MIP-1β would otherwise initiate upon receptor engagement.
On the other hand, proteins like Evasin-1 and Evasin-4, found in tick saliva, represent a different approach, where they bind to chemokines such as MIP-1β directly, preventing them from interacting with their receptors. Although not chemical in nature, they illustrate a method by which MIP-1β activity can be neutralized. Synthetic compounds like Bindarit can reduce the synthesis of a broad range of chemokines, which may include MIP-1β, thus lowering its presence and availability for receptor binding. Other compounds, such as Cyclosporin A and Dexamethasone, act more generally to suppress immune function and inflammation, which can lead to a decrease in chemokine levels, including MIP-1β.
